U1010 CONTROL UNIT (CAN)
Description
INFOID:0000000000988646
CAN (Controller Area Network) is a serial communication line for real time application. It is an on-vehicle mul-
tiplex communication line with high data communication speed and excellent malfunction detection ability.
Many electronic control units are equipped onto a vehicle, and each control unit shares information and links
with other control units during operation (not independent). In CAN communication, control units are con-
nected with 2 communication lines (CAN-H and CAN-L) allowing a high rate of information transmission with
less wiring. Each control unit transmits/receives data but selectively reads required data only.

P0703 STOP LAMP SWITCH
P0703 STOP LAMP SWITCH
Description
INFOID:0000000000988649
ON, OFF status of the stop lamp switch is sent via the CAN communication from the BCM to TCM using the
signal.

Diagnosis Procedure
INFOID:0000000000988651
1.
CHECK STOP LAMP SWITCH
Check stop lamp switch.
Is the inspection result normal?
YES
>>
Check the following. If NG, repair or replace damaged parts.
• Harness for short or open between battery and stop lamp switch.
• Harness for short or open between stop lamp switch and BCM.
• 10A fuse (No. 11, located in fuse block).
NO
>> Repair or replace the stop lamp switch.

P0705 PARK/NEUTRAL POSITION SWITCH
P0705 PARK/NEUTRAL POSITION SWITCH
Description
INFOID:0000000000988653
• The PNP switch assembly includes a transaxle range switch.
• The transaxle range switch detects the selector lever position and sends a signal to the TCM.
